Output 2d392896e6dc76a7a3ad985f6f95aa1141e80085fa583d51781b6c58d0a4f55b:2

value
53636845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0458b764a5d987587fd139387492ff893ffe67a OP_EQUAL
address
3GJTMHuFTNWAqUHNqkBHVWqSrnpTpt84Tu
transaction
2d392896e6dc76a7a3ad985f6f95aa1141e80085fa583d51781b6c58d0a4f55b
spent
true